Auto Accompaniment
5
Press the [MAIN A] button.
6
Press the [INTRO] button.
7
As soon as you play a chord with your left hand, the auto
accompaniment starts.
For this example, play a C major chord (as shown below).
For information on how to enter chords, see “Chord Fingerings” on page 40.
When the playback of the intro is finished, it automatically leads into main A
section.
The indicator of the
destination section (MAIN A/
B/C/D) will flash while the
corresponding fill-in is
playing. During this time you
can change the destination
section by pressing the
appropriate MAIN/AUTO FILL
[A], [B], [C] or [D] button.
You can use the intro section
even in the middle of the
song by pressing the
[INTRO] button during the
song.
If the MAIN/AUTO FILL A/B /
C/D button is pressed after
the final half beat (eighth
note) of the measure, fill-in
will begin from the next
measure.
8
Press the [MAIN B] button.
A fill-in plays, automatically followed by the main B section.
9
Press the MAIN buttons as desired during your performance.
The main section corresponding to the pressed button plays following an
automatic fill-in.
10
Press the [ENDING] button.
This switches to the ending section.
When the ending is finished, the auto
accompaniment automatically stops.
You can have the ending gradually slow down (ritardando) by pressing the
[ENDING]
button again while the ending is playing back.
If you press the INTRO/
COUNT INTRO button while
the ending is playing, the
intro section will begin
playing after the ending is
finished.
If you press a MAIN/AUTO
FILL button while the ending
is playing, fill-in accompani-
ment will immediately start
playing, continuing with the
main section.
If you press the [SYNC
START] button
while an
accompaniment is playing,
the accompaniment will stop
and the PSR-740/640 will
enter Synchronized Start
standby status.
You can begin the
accompaniment by using the
ending instead of the intro
section.
